Mental health is too often associated with special circumstances, debilitating disease or something that just 'doesn't apply to me'. These ARE all related, but actually everyone is affected by mental health concerns. It is time to eliminate the stigma attached and allow ourselves to address our own and others' mental health concerns. For more information click on the link below:

Latest news in the world of s*xual and reproductive health - can one pill be the answer to s*xually transmitted infections? Read more below from Bhekisisa Centre for Health Journalism:
One pill within three days of condomless s*x could stop three STIs. Here’s how it works – Bhekisisa A cheap antibiotic (called doxycycline) used to treat skin infections and to stop people from getting malaria could also work to prevent chlamydia, gonorrhoea and syphilis, found a United States study in men who have s*x with men and transgender women.
